Additional capabilities that matter to educational institutions

Beyond basic contact management, consider automation, bulk operations, API access, audit capabilities, template controls, and support for institutional compliance when comparing platforms.

Bulk Send

signNow supports Bulk Send for distributing identical documents to many recipients with individualized tracking, which reduces administrative time for enrollment forms and permission slips.

Templates and Team Templates

Both platforms offer templates, but signNow’s team templates enable centralized template management with controlled editing rights for departmental consistency and reduced versioning errors.

API and developer access

signNow provides REST APIs for integration into SIS and other campus systems; Streak offers API access focused on CRM data in Gmail, which may require additional bridging for signature flows.

Audit trails

signNow generates detailed audit logs for each signature event, including timestamps and IP data, which assist in compliance and dispute resolution.

Authentication options

signNow supports multiple signer authentication methods including email, SMS pin, and SSO; Streak relies on Gmail identity with limited native signer authentication for formal eSignatures.

Role-based permissions

signNow’s permission model supports granular administrative roles suitable for district-level governance, while Streak emphasizes user-level CRM permissions inside Gmail.

Core integration and contact features relevant to education

Key features that influence selection include integration depth with Google Workspace, centralized contact directories, and how each vendor structures group and organizational management in pricing tiers.

Google Workspace integration

signNow supports direct Google Drive and Docs workflows with native add-ons for document import and signing; Streak operates inside Gmail and offers CRM-style pipelines but requires additional configuration for centralized document signature workflows.

Contact directory

signNow provides centralized contact storage and organization-level address books useful for district-wide deployments; Streak uses contact threads within Gmail that can be simpler for single-team use but less centralized for institution-wide governance.

Group and team management

signNow includes role-based teams and shared templates to enforce consistent document handling across departments; Streak groups contacts into pipelines that excel at tracking stages rather than formal organizational hierarchies.

Pricing alignment

signNow pricing tiers often separate eSignature and enterprise controls, making seat allocation explicit; Streak’s pricing focuses on CRM features inside Gmail, which can be cost-effective for small teams but may require add-ons for advanced eSignature needs.

Best practices for secure and accurate deployment in education

Adopt operational practices that reduce risk, improve completion rates, and make cost predictable when using signNow or Streak CRM in education environments.

Centralize contact management and templates
Maintain a single canonical contact store and restrict template editing to designated administrators. Centralized templates reduce version drift, ensure consistent legal language, and simplify permission audits across departments.
Enforce SSO and role-based access
Require institution SSO for staff accounts and limit privileged actions to specific roles. SSO reduces credential sprawl and integrates with campus identity systems for easier offboarding and privileged access reviews.
Document retention and audit configurations
Define retention policies that meet institutional and legal obligations, enable comprehensive audit trails, and schedule periodic exports of signed documents to institution-managed archives for long-term preservation.
Pilot and measure before full rollout
Run a pilot with representative users, measure completion rates, support load, and integration behavior. Use pilot outcomes to refine seat counts, template structure, and training materials before scaling.
